Installation:

  • Read and understand plans and diagrams for the project.
  • Ensure all tools, materials and equipment needed for the project are in company vehicle.
  • Read and understand the manufacturer’s instructions and manuals related to the installation.
  • Locate all points of equipment installation.
  • Professionally create access points for the installation.
  • Install all products as per manufacturer’s instructions and clients plans.
  • Termination and routing of category, coaxial, speakers and related low voltage communications cabling.
  • Keeps personal equipment operating by following operating instructions; maintaining supplies; and reported necessary maintenance as needed.
  • Follow safety procedures by wearing protective clothing and gear.

Administration:

  • Maintain proper notes and admin on projects in Hive’s iPoint database.
  • Document installation actions by completing forms.
  • Record time and materials used on the job.
  • Maintain company vehicle as per Hive policies.

Communication:

  • Maintain communication with Project Manager to keep him informed of project progress.
